[
https://issues.apache.org/jira/browse/CASSANDRA-1434?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Jonathan Ellis updated CASSANDRA-1434:
--------------------------------------
Attachment: 1434-v6.txt
v6.
bq. There is a race condition in put() between !run and the put itself
not really. the check in put is just an attempt to abort earlier if possible.
bq. Exceptions thrown by child threads will be logged, but not reported to the
Hadoop frontend
saved actual exceptions.
bq. the second open in RangeClient is getting TTransportException: Socket
already connected
fixed
bq. Logging a NPE for the first batch is pretty ugly
nothing is logged. the alternatives strike me as uglier.
bq. The default batchSize was increased back up to Long.MAX_VALUE
fixed
> ColumnFamilyOutputFormat performs blocking writes for large batches
> -------------------------------------------------------------------
>
> Key: CASSANDRA-1434
> URL: https://issues.apache.org/jira/browse/CASSANDRA-1434
> Project: Cassandra
> Issue Type: Bug
> Components: Hadoop
> Reporter: Stu Hood
> Assignee: Jonathan Ellis
> Fix For: 0.7 beta 2
>
> Attachments:
> 0001-Switch-away-from-Multimap-and-fix-regression-introdu.patch,
> 0002-Improve-concurrency-and-add-basic-retries-by-attempt.patch,
> 0003-Switch-RingCache-back-to-multimap.patch,
> 0004-Replace-Executor-with-map-of-threads.patch, 1434-v3.txt, 1434-v4.txt,
> 1434-v5.txt, 1434-v6.txt
>
>
> By default, ColumnFamilyOutputFormat batches
> {{mapreduce.output.columnfamilyoutputformat.batch.threshold}} or
> {{Long.MAX_VALUE}} mutations, and then performs a blocking write.
--
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.